Founded in 1990, the Wimbledon Hawks play in the highest division of the British Australian Rules Football League (BARFL).  Each team is made up of 18 players and 4 reserves, and at least half the players must be European passport holders.  The Hawks family come from all over the world including England, Ireland, New Zealand, Canada, Holland, Australia and South Africa.  The club won the premiership in 1993, 1994, 1996 and 1998, and were runners up in 1997 & 2001.  Our second team, the Fulham Hawks, play in the Conference division.
